Job Description for CAD Drafter/Designer

 

CAD drafter/designer, working in conjunction under the direction of engineers, is responsible for creating detailed drawings that are utilized in the planning and construction of civil engineering projects including utility (water and wastewater) lines, pump stations, treatment plants and similar projects.  These detailed technical drawings incorporate the input of engineers and surveyors and can specify dimensions, codes, materials, and construction methods.  Duties will also include the preparation of survey plats, drawings, topographic maps and site layouts from survey field notes.

 

CAD Drafter/Designer Duties and Responsibilities

 

The are general duties and responsibilities of the CAD drafter/designer is expected to perform include:

 

  • Uses CAD software (Civil 3D) to create detailed drawings that include dimensions, procedures and required materials.  Also uses views and angles to show the association between system components, often consulting co-workers regarding design and layouts.
  • Coordinates the collection of data and incorporates such information into drawings, maps and schematics, while consulting with engineers, surveyors and other workers involved to prepare drawings.
  • Takes care of complex drafting and designing assignments with little to no supervision and reviews drawings for accuracy and completeness.  Also, maintains all revisions of project drawings.
  • Creates drawings and layouts from verbal and written instructions from the project engineer.  Examines and checks engineering drawings to comply with company standards.
  • Incorporates data from surveys and reports to prepare drawings, as well as makes calculations for preparation of drawings and designs.
  • Works closely with engineers, designers and other drafters to ensure the maintenance of coordination design efforts.  Completes project responsibilities within scope, schedule and budget.
  • Coordinates and communicates with other professionals to understand design concepts and establish requirements.  When a deficiency is found, revises designs to eliminate problems.

Important CAD Drafter/Designer Qualities

To be effective and efficient as a CAD drafter/designer, one should have the following competencies:

 

Plan Reading

Must have the ability to read and understand construction drawings of various complexities.

 

Detail-Oriented

A CAD drafter/designer should pay close attention to detail, so the drawings being prepared will be technically accurate.

 

Technical Skills

Must have the ability to work with Autodesk Civil 3D, Microsoft Office, and other computer software as required for day to day operations.

 

Math Skills

These are important since working with technical drawings requires mathematical calculations involving angles and weights, not to mention costs.

 

Critical-Thinking Skills

A drafter/designer helps engineers by identifying problems with designs and plans and recommends solutions.

 

Time-Management Skills

As a CAD drafter/designer, one works under strict deadlines, but should still be able to produce the required output in accordance with schedules.

 

Interpersonal Skills

This is a basic, considering that a drafter/designer works closely with other professionals to ensure the accuracy of final plans and drawings.
